The primary form for independent contractor payment is the 1099 form, which clients use to report payments made to you. Additionally, as an independent contractor, you will use Schedule C to report your income and expenses during tax time. Independent contractors usually fill out a W-9 form to provide their Taxpayer Identification Number to clients. Additionally, when it comes time to file taxes, they will complete Schedule C to report their income and expenses.
